Output 3134aa52f5819051bb6fbc322426c4a709b6a0b0356e7e468a550e5cfd9cf6f5:2

value
868933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1c368562421e51f44ab2c77b4101b8b7c69542d OP_EQUAL
address
3PjLrvvQBW2y4U6T2RPqVF4bRvkXR4jJNg
transaction
3134aa52f5819051bb6fbc322426c4a709b6a0b0356e7e468a550e5cfd9cf6f5
confirmations
389656
spent
true